V形弹簧试验方法的研究 被引量:3

Research on Testing Methods of Chevron Spring

摘要 金属—橡胶复合V形弹簧主要应用于城市地铁、轻轨等机车车辆的一系悬挂系统,可以传递轮对的牵引力和制动力;在垂直方向给车体以弹性支撑;在列车的纵向和横向提供柔性连接和限位的作用。由于具有结构易调整、减振降噪功能显著、质量轻、安装使用方便等优点,正在逐渐替代原有的金属弹簧。国外对于V形弹簧的研究日渐成熟,而我国还处于引进仿制阶段。本文在开发试制不同结构和型号V形弹簧的基础上,结合国外产品技术规范和有关报道,总结了有关V形弹簧的试验和数据处理方法,重点介绍了三向静刚度试验、粘结强度试验、极限载荷试验、蠕变试验、疲劳试验方法等,并简单介绍了V形弹簧的结构和工作原理。 Chevron spring with the rubber and metal samdwich structure have been used in the primary suspension of locomotive and vehicle.It has the effect of transmitting pull and brake of wheel pairs, flexible support of bodywork in vertical, supplying flexible connection and limit in longitudinal and lateral. Since chevron spring has the property of easy adjusting the structure, the excellent damping property, light weight and facility setting and using property, it will substitute metal spring. The research on chevron spring is grown up aboard, but it is still in the stage of copy in our country. In this paper, the testing method and data processing method are concluded, which based on our research on the trial- manufacture of vary kinds and structure of chevron spring and outland report and technical specification. The methods of stiffness test, bond stiffness test, proof load test, creeping test and endurance test are introduced in detail. The structure and work mechanism of chevron spring are introduced simply.
